Tenable Holdings Inc
Glance View
In the sprawling landscape of cybersecurity, Tenable Holdings Inc. has carved out a significant niche, driven by the increasing complexity of digital networks and the relentless rise of cyber threats. Founded in 2002, the company focuses on vulnerability management, offering its clients insights into where their digital infrastructures might be at risk. This becomes critical as organizations rely heavily on interconnected systems, from cloud applications to on-premise servers, and everything in between. Tenable's flagship product, Nessus, has become synonymous with vulnerability scanning, enabling businesses to proactively identify and mitigate security risks before malicious actors can exploit them. Tenable generates revenue through a subscription-based model, catering to enterprises of all sizes with a flexible, scalable approach. By offering both on-premises and cloud-based solutions, Tenable ensures that its services adapt to the evolving needs of its customers. The company has expanded its product portfolio beyond Nessus with offerings like Tenable.io and Tenable.sc, which provide wider capabilities such as continuous visibility and predictive prioritization. This suite not only helps in maintaining compliance and governance standards but also supports proactive risk management. Tenable's business model thrives on the increasing regulatory scrutiny and the growing awareness among businesses of the importance of comprehensive cybersecurity practices, making its solutions indispensable in the current digital era.

What is Tenable Holdings Inc's Revenue?
Revenue
999.4m
USD
Based on the financial report for Dec 31, 2025, Tenable Holdings Inc's Revenue amounts to 999.4m USD.
What is Tenable Holdings Inc's Revenue growth rate?
Revenue CAGR 5Y
18%
Over the last year, the Revenue growth was 11%. The average annual Revenue growth rates for Tenable Holdings Inc have been 14% over the past three years , 18% over the past five years .
